A crawl space dehumidifier is a worthwhile investment, particularly in humid climates or if you've noticed musty odors, mold growth, or wood deterioration. Though costs range from $3,000 to $9,200, this investment helps prevent structural damage that could require far more expensive repairs later. Beyond structural protection, a properly dehumidified crawl space contributes to better overall indoor air quality and may reduce allergens throughout your home. Consider having a professional assessment to determine if your specific situation warrants this investment.

Addressing crawl space moisture effectively often requires a combination of solutions. A complete approach includes encapsulation plus dehumidifier installation. For minor moisture issues, a basic dehumidifier starting at $1,500 may suffice, while severe problems in larger spaces could require systems costing up to $14,000. The most effective moisture control strategy depends on your specific conditions, making a professional assessment valuable for determining the most cost-effective approach for your situation.

For a crawl space measuring 1,500 square feet, you'll need a dehumidifier with a daily capacity of 30 to 50 pints, with unit costs ranging from $150 to $600. Your local climate and existing moisture levels may necessitate adjusting this capacity—homes in particularly humid regions might benefit from higher-capacity units. Professional installers can measure your specific humidity conditions and recommend equipment that is appropriately sized, balancing initial cost with operating efficiency for your unique situation.

Crawl space dehumidifiers add $300 to $500 to your annual electricity expenses when operating continuously. Energy-efficient models reduce this consumption by roughly 15 to 30% compared to standard units. Most contemporary dehumidifiers feature humidity sensors that automatically cycle operation based on current conditions, helping manage energy usage. Proper crawl space encapsulation significantly improves efficiency by creating a controlled environment that requires less dehumidifier runtime, thereby reducing ongoing electricity costs.
